MNB-2 All-Purpose Mainsail $14,799
3DL 850 Carbon/Technora 19600 DPI
Updated for 2012, we have made small changes to the design, luff curve and batten configuration. The MNB-2 design has been developed from the original mainsail design to
match the new mast tune and max forestay tension. It is more powerful
in the head for light conditions and slightly above the minimum class
weight but still an All-Purpose design. It is built with 19600 dpi for
better shapeholding through the racing seasons due to the Class sail
yearly restrictions.
MNi-2 Mainsail $16,387
3Di™ 780i Carbon/Dyneema 19600 DPI CSD Layout
New 2012 layout with small changes to design, luff curve and batten configuration.
With 3Di™ technology, we are able to give the sail more modulus for the
same weight and more control of headstay sag because the mainsheet load
is transferred directly to the boat through the carbon leech yarns.
Early trials show this sail to have more flexibility and shapeholding
through the wind ranges due to the more efficient 3Di structure. |

LMB-2 Light/Medium Headsail $8,676
3DL 850 Carbon/Technora 16800 DPI
Thin Films
For 2012, we have made small changes to the design and geometry of this Carbon/Technora sail which was developed from our very successful LM mold. We increased the DPI and reduced overall weight of the sail to improve the wind range and durability. The new LMB-2 design is slightly more powerful and has a rounder entry to compensate for the higher forestay tension used now in the Class. We have maximized the sail area by increasing the foot and leech length to maximum Class dimension and allow the clew to be as low as possible. This allows the sail to be sheeted at closer angle for better pointing.
DESIGNED WIND RANGE:
0 - 13 knots true wind speed |

LMi-2 Light/Medium Headsail $10,452
3Di™ 780i Carbon/Dyneema 16800 DPI CSD Layout
New 2012 Layout with small changes to design and geometry. By using North 3Di™ technology, the LMi-2 has been engineered to save overall weight and still have a higher modulus than the LMB-2. It is a powerful sail with a wider groove for easier steering in under-powered conditions but still easy to de-power in the upper range by adjusting the "up & down" and sheet tension. We have maximized the sail area by increasing the foot and leech length to maximum Class dimensions and allowing the clew to be as low as possible. This allows the sail to be sheeted at closer angle for better pointing.
DESIGNED WIND RANGE:
0 - 13 knots true wind speed |

MHB-2 Medium/Heavy Headsail $9,321
3DL 850 Carbon/Technora 19600 DPI
For 2012, we have made small changes to the design and geometry of this Medium Heavy jib. We have kept the sail area to a maximum for better performance in the lower range and made the entry rounder and the sail slightly more powerful to compensate for the higher forestay tension used now in the Class.
DESIGNED WIND RANGE:
12 -19 knots true wind speed |
|
MHi-2 Medium/Heavy Headsail $11,023
3Di 780i Carbon/Dyneema 19600 DPI CSD Layout
News 2012 Layout with small changes to design and geometry.
The MHi-2 headsail has the same design characteristics of the MHB-1 and
has been engineered to have a higher modulus. Early trials have shown
that this sail requires less trimming attention in changing conditions
and allows you to keep the weight to windward all the time for better
stability. In the upper range of the MHi-2, you can easily twist the top
batten by easing the sheet and/or the "up & down" control without
losing control of the mid leech. This allows for better acceleration
without losing pointing ability.
DESIGNED WIND RANGE:
12-20 knots true wind speed
|
|
H4B-2 Headsail $6,125
Paneled Construction (per Class Rules) Dimension BX 20
The H4B-2 has been re-designed for 2012 with small changes to design and geometry.
The H4B-2 has an increased overall entry angle and bottom quarter depth to allow a wider steering groove. The final sail area has been reduced slightly to allow for better performance in the upper range of the sail.
DESIGNED WIND RANGE:
19+ knots true wind speed |

CLASS DOWNWIND
For 2012, North Sails has redesigned the entire Soto 40 downwind
inventory to provide more versatile flying shapes for more aggressive
"mode" sailing in each wind range. The class allows only three
Masthead Spinnakers to be measured in any regatta. Minimum weight is 30
grams/m2. After two years of racing in the Soto 40 Class, we have
invested many hours of R&D with our own VWT (Virtual Wind Tunnel).
As a result, we have re-designed all our spinnaker inventory, materials
and construction to better meet the AWA that the boat sails in for each
wind condition.

CODE A1.5-2 $9,137
NorLite 50/60*
SuperLite 50/60
Area: 178.6 Square Meters
APPLICATION:
Optimized for 50-95 degrees AWA the new A1.5-2 has been redesigned to be more powerful and with a new geometry to allow max sail area . By going to maximum luff length allowed by the Class this new A1.5-2 design has 4 square meters more sail area than the previous A1.25-1 and 2,1 square meters more than the A1.5-1. It is easier to sail at lower angles something that becomes tactically very important in this Class and thanks to the new sail geometry , this new A1.5 has a nice and twisty shape to be fast when sailing tighter angles in the light breeze.
SPECIALIZED WIND RANGE:
5-14 knots true wind speed
* - Recommended sail cloth |
